Subject: On-call handoff — PointsLedger

Hi Mirella,

Welcome to the rotation. The loyalty-points ledger in Brindlewick's PointsLedger service reconciles nightly; most pages come from mismatched accrual totals. Check the reconciliation job logs first, then the retry queue. Escalate only if drift exceeds 0.5%. The triage steps and dashboard links live on our internal wiki page.

runbook for badug-kadup: https://confluence.zemvarlabs.internal/projects/browse/display/projects/bd1b

- [ ] Step 7: Archive cold storage buckets (Glacierline tier). Confirm both ceremony witnesses are present, verify bucket manifests match the Oxbow ledger, then seal the archive key shares. Plugin authors may observe but not handle shares. Once sealed, the archive index itself is encrypted and can only be reopened with the passphrase below.

vault phrase of badup-hahig = tamael-aldael-kelmir-istael-fenok-istwyn-tamius-jorath-oliion

FeedLint checks podcast RSS feeds for malformed enclosures, missing episode GUIDs, and bad artwork dimensions. As a plugin author, you register validation rules through the rule registry; each rule receives a parsed feed object and returns a list of findings. Findings are persisted so publishers can track regressions across runs. Your development environment ships with a seeded findings database containing sample feeds in various broken states. To query it during plugin development, use the connection string below.

primary connection of yagep-kahip = redis://giliel_svc:zYiKsLL2PLpfPL@db-348f.xolmarsys.corp:5432/fenwyn

## Ticket: Circuit breaker drift — Marlow upstream API

Support has seen intermittent timeouts from the Marlow pricing API because the production circuit breaker thresholds drifted from the reviewed settings. The breaker now trips too late, so users see long hangs instead of fast fallbacks. No action needed from support beyond flagging affected cases. The intended breaker configuration, for comparison against production, is listed below.

deployment values, yadug-bawif:
[framir]
team = pelox
access_code = ac_a38ab2
owner = tamion.julael
host = framir.tolvaqlabs.test
port = 11211
peer = tammir.zemvargrid.local
salt = 2215ef03
pin = 1541